what are the actions, origins and insertions of the
rectus abdominus |
actions- lumbar flexion and lateral flexion
origins- crest of pubis and symphesis insertions- inserts on cartilage of ribs 5-7 and xiphoid process |

what are the actions, origins and insertions of the
iliopsoas |
actions- it flexes the hip, external rotation and stabilisation of the hip
origins- iliacus- iliac fossa on inner surface of ilium psoas major- lower borders of vertebrae and T12 and base of sacrum insertions- lesser trochanter of femur via iliopsoas tendon |

what are the actions, origins and insertions of the
sartorius |
actions- it flexes, adducts and externally rotates rotates femur and flexes the knee
origins- Anterior superior iliac spine and notch just below spine insertions- anterior medial condyle of tibia |
